Bursting with colorful flowers, the 18″ Oriental Poppy is a delightfully complex Tiffany lamp design. Three horizontal border rows barely contain the exuberant blooms as they create a three dimensional vista of color. This example, created in 2014 for a local client, has an explosion lush red and orange poppiesĀ set against vibrant blues, purples, and greens. The shade is shown on the elegant Library base (22.5″ tall).
